The Promise of XREAL AURA
XREAL AURA, formerly known as 'Project Aura', is designed to deliver an immersive AR experience with its advanced hardware and software capabilities. At its core, the device boasts Qualcomm's Snapdragon Reality Elite chipset, promising significant performance boosts in GPU, CPU, and neural processing compared to its predecessor, the Snapdragon XR2+ Gen 2. This chipset, in combination with XREAL's X1S Spatial Coprocessor, ensures efficient management of display and sensor processing, a critical aspect of AR technology.
A Lightweight, Immersive Experience
One of the standout features of XREAL AURA is its lightweight design, weighing in at less than 95 grams. This is achieved through the use of birdbath optics, which deliver a 70-degree field-of-view (FOV), providing a wide and immersive digital canvas without compromising on comfort. The glasses also support six degrees of freedom (6DOF) tracking, hand tracking, and multimodal AI experiences, further enhancing the interactivity and realism of the AR environment.
Android XR: A World of Applications
Running on Android XR, XREAL AURA offers access to a vast array of applications. Users can not only utilize existing Android apps from the Google Play Store but also explore a growing catalog of applications specifically designed for extended reality. Pricing and Availability
XREAL AURA is expected to hit the market this fall, with a price tag that won't exceed $1,500, excluding taxes. The company is offering two reservation options: a 'Founder Priority Pass' for $300, guaranteeing first batch shipments and a discount on the final price, and a $100 reservation fee for later shipments, which will also result in a $200 discount. The glasses will be available in the US, UK, Japan, South Korea, and select EU countries.
